@oursin_360: Thanks. No soldering required. All the parts (buttons, stick and board) can be found quite easily online. The box/frame is all custom built using wood and sheet metal. None of it hard to do it just takes a little time and patience. Anyone can do it and it's a great little project. I will say this though, by the time I was finished I could have bought an official stick with the money I spent. But that don't matter to me because I love the design side of it and the pride in saying "I made that". What some people are doing though is buying last gen sticks and modding them with a new board and stuff.
